Living with depression
Is like watching people
Around you breathing
But instead
Your blue lips inhale
Words of self-hatred
And you know you should
Be able to fill
Your lungs with fresh
Oxygen like everyone else
But you can't
And the worst part is
People mistake your chest
Frantically rising
Up and down as breathing
When in reality
You're suffocating
